Colloidal particles were sedimented onto patterned glass slides to grow three-dimensional bicrystals with a controlled structure. Three types of symmetric tilt grain boundaries between close-packed face-centered-cubic crystals were produced: Σ5(100),Σ17(100), and Σ3(110). Grain growth rates in sputtered Cu thin films were found to be influenced by impurity levels of the sputtering targets. The Cu thin films with thickness of 100 nm or 1mm were deposited on the rigid substrates by a sputter-deposition technique using the Cu target with purity of 99.99% (4N) or 99.9999% (6N), then subsequently annealed at room temperatures. The sensitization and subsequent intergranular corrosion of Al-5.3 wt.% Mg alloy has been shown to be an important factor in stress corrosion cracking of Al-Mg alloys. Understanding sensitization requires the review of grain boundary character on the precipitation process which can assist in developing and designing alloys with improved corrosion resistance. Grain v1 is one of the 7 final candidates of ECRYPT eStream project, which involves in the 80-bit secret key. Grain-128 is a variant version with 128-bit secret key, and Grain v0 is the original version in the first evaluation phase.
